Variant summary

Our verdict is Likely benign. The variant received -5 ACMG points: 0P and 5B. BP6BS2

The NM_003482.4(KMT2D):​c.8137G>A​(p.Ala2713Thr) variant causes a missense change. The variant allele was found at a frequency of 0.0000205 in 1,612,126 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. A2713E) has been classified as Uncertain significance.

Genes affected
KMT2D (HGNC:7133): (lysine methyltransferase 2D) The protein encoded by this gene is a histone methyltransferase that methylates the Lys-4 position of histone H3. The encoded protein is part of a large protein complex called ASCOM, which has been shown to be a transcriptional regulator of the beta-globin and estrogen receptor genes. Mutations in this gene have been shown to be a cause of Kabuki syndrome. [provided by RefSeq, Oct 2010]
